Output 589f2a7c1c02b0dde593ea5c0e75c5ae37f5a4ecc4ca8112c6ee691950c8da70:0

value
2004
script pubkey
OP_0 OP_PUSHBYTES_20 8d594c8431962924bd51d42d8d66c227293d1e07
address
bc1q34v5epp3jc5jf0236skc6ekzyu5n68s8cd399l
transaction
589f2a7c1c02b0dde593ea5c0e75c5ae37f5a4ecc4ca8112c6ee691950c8da70
confirmations
260270
spent
true